Cherry Blossom in Japan


Ever wondered what exactly is Cherry blossom and why people flock to Japan to visit it. Do you know how people in Japan celebrate it? What are some amazing spots to watch it?

All this and more. Find it out in the video below!!! I am sure you will be left craving to visit Japan as soon as possible :)